Q: What cars have a blind spot camera?

A: Volvo and Ford both use a sensor-based system that provides the driver with a warning if a vehicle enters his blind spot while he is changing lanes. Mercedes, Nissan, Chrysler, and many other automakers also offer their own blind spot warning, monitoring, or alert systems.

Q: What is BMW’s active blind spot detection?

A: BMW’s Active Blind Spot Detection system aids drivers when they change lanes by warning them of vehicles in their blind spots, helping to reduce the chance of having an accident. The system uses radar sensors to monitor the space around the car.

Q: What is a blind spot sensor?

A: Blind spot sensors are radar units normally located on the sides of the vehicle, behind the rear bumper cover, in the quarter panel, and sometimes behind the front bumper. These sensors monitor the locations of other vehicles that the driver cannot see.

Q: What is a blind spot warning system?

A: Blindspot Warning System. Blind Spot Warning is a technology that detects and warns of vehicles that cannot be seen by the driver, typically this occurs when a vehicle is behind and to one side of the vehicle it is overtaking “blind spot”.
